Costa Dorado hotel recommendations?

I've accepted that our mini trip budget won't stretch to the sunshine state this month so am planning to take DD (10) to Spain for a long weekend.

Thinking of flying into Reus and staying around Salou area which I think is quite near the airport?

Anyone been to this area, got any recommendations or steer well clear of advice?

I went to Salou once and stayed in an apartment near the Cambrils side of Salou, despite the fact there was a very noisy train line behind the apartments. Personally I preferred the look of this area rather than some of the more built-up bits of Salou. If I went back to the area I would stay in Cambrils instead.

We stayed at the Santa Monica Playa in Salou and it was a lovely hotel. It had just been renovated and the rooms were lovely. It's just across from Charlie Chaplins bar and is central for everything.
We went on a sunshine cruise on a catamarran and also did a jeep safari which was the highlight of the holiday.
Universal was good fun as well, but I only rode Dragon Khan once!
